Advised Therapy Schedules
When planning your therapy routine for hair restoration, consistency is essential to achieving ideal outcomes. Many specialists suggest beginning with three sessions per week for the first month. This constant treatment assists start the hair reconstruction process by promoting hair roots and advertising flow in the scalp.
As you advance, you can progressively minimize the regularity to 2 sessions weekly for the following 2 to 3 months. This modification enables your scalp to continue gaining from the therapy while offering you some flexibility in your timetable.
After this first duration, many locate that once-a-week sessions can preserve the results you've attained, especially if you're combining cold laser treatment with various other hair restoration strategies.
Always pay attention to your body; if you really feel any type of pain or don't see results, consult your doctor for personalized guidance. Tracking your development can also assist you identify if changes to your routine are required.
